Understanding the "Fast": What Are We Trying to Protect?

Before we judge Coke Zero, we must define what "breaking a fast" means in a biological context. The goal of intermittent fasting is to maintain a metabolic state conducive to specific benefits. Primarily, this involves:

  1. Low Insulin Levels: Insulin is the primary storage hormone. When you eat, especially carbohydrates and protein, insulin rises to shuttle nutrients into cells. A "fasted" state is characterized by low, baseline insulin levels, allowing lipolysis (fat breakdown) to occur.
  2. Ketosis: For many fasters, especially those on keto, a goal is to enter ketosis, where the body burns fat-derived ketones for fuel instead of glucose. This typically happens after 12-16 hours of fasting.
  3. Autophagy: This is the cellular "spring cleaning" process where cells remove damaged components. Autophagy is believed to be significantly upregulated during prolonged fasting periods (typically beyond 18-24 hours).
  4. Metabolic Rest & Digestive Rest: Giving your digestive system a prolonged break can reduce inflammation and improve gut health.

When we ask "does Coke Zero break a fast?" we are essentially asking: Can its ingredients disrupt any of these four key processes? If a substance spikes insulin, knocks you out of ketosis, or inhibits autophagy, it could be considered to "break" the fast for that specific goal. The answer isn't a simple yes or no; it depends on your primary goal for fasting and your individual metabolic response.

Deconstructing Coke Zero: What's Actually in the Can?

To analyze the impact, we must look at the ingredient list. A standard can of Coca-Cola Zero Sugar contains:

  • Carbonated Water
  • Caramel Color
  • Phosphoric Acid
  • Aspartame (a potent artificial sweetener)
  • Potassium Benzoate (a preservative)
  • Natural Flavors (proprietary blend)
  • Acesulfame Potassium (another artificial sweetener, often used in combination with aspartame)
  • Caffeine

The two primary suspects for any potential "fast-breaking" effect are aspartame and acesulfame potassium (Ace-K). Both are intensely sweet, non-nutritive sweeteners (NNS) that provide the sugary taste without calories. But their interaction with the body is where the controversy lies.

The Sweetener Spotlight: Aspartame & Ace-K

  • Aspartame: A methyl ester of the dipeptide aspartyl-phenylalanine. It’s about 200 times sweeter than sucrose. It’s metabolized in the small intestine into phenylalanine, aspartic acid, and methanol. These metabolites do have calories, but the amounts from a can of Coke Zero are negligible (less than 1 kcal) and are not considered to provide meaningful energy.
  • Acesulfame Potassium (Ace-K): A calorie-free sweetener about 200 times sweeter than sugar. It’s not metabolized by the body and is excreted unchanged in urine.

The central debate hinges on whether these sweeteners, by tasting sweet, can trigger a cephalic phase response—a neurological reflex where the body anticipates incoming calories and preps metabolic processes, including a small insulin release. This is the "sweet taste without calories" paradox.

The Insulin Response: The Most Critical Factor

Insulin is the master hormone of storage. A true fast aims to keep insulin at its lowest possible baseline. The pivotal question is: Do artificial sweeteners in Coke Zero cause an insulin spike?

The research is mixed and often confusing, with results varying wildly based on:

  • The specific sweetener (some studies show Ace-K may have a more pronounced effect than aspartame).
  • The individual's metabolic health (insulin-sensitive vs. insulin-resistant individuals may respond differently).
  • The presence of other compounds (like caffeine, which can have complex effects on insulin sensitivity).
  • The study design (many are acute, small-scale, or in animals, not humans in a real-world fasting context).

What the evidence suggests:

  • For healthy, lean individuals: Most well-controlled studies show that aspartame and Ace-K, consumed alone, do not cause a significant rise in blood glucose or insulin in the short term. The cephalic phase insulin response, if any, is minimal and transient.
  • For individuals with insulin resistance, prediabetes, or obesity: Some studies indicate these populations may experience a more noticeable insulin response to sweet tastes, even non-caloric ones. This could be due to an exaggerated cephalic phase response or altered gut microbiome signaling.
  • The "Sweetness Without Calories" Mismatch: Some researchers theorize that chronic exposure to intensely sweet, non-caloric substances may dampen the cephalic phase response over time or disrupt appetite regulation, but the acute insulin-spike concern is likely overblown for most people.

Practical Takeaway: If your primary fasting goal is weight loss via calorie restriction and low insulin, the evidence leans toward Coke Zero not causing a significant, fast-breaking insulin spike for the average person. However, if you are metabolically unhealthy, you might be more sensitive. Using a continuous glucose monitor (CGM) is the only way to know for sure how your body reacts.

Beyond Insulin: Other Physiological Considerations

Even if insulin remains stable, could Coke Zero interfere with other fasting benefits?

1. Autophagy: The Cellular Cleanup

Autophagy is primarily upregulated by nutrient deprivation and low energy status (high AMPK, low mTOR). The key triggers are the absence of amino acids and energy (calories). There is no credible scientific evidence that artificial sweeteners or the other ingredients in Coke Zero inhibit autophagy. The sweeteners provide no amino acids or usable energy. The minuscule amounts of phenylalanine/aspartic acid from aspartame metabolism are trivial and would not signal "nutrient abundance" to cells in a way that shuts down autophagy. For autophagy-focused fasts (typically 24+ hours), Coke Zero is highly unlikely to be a disruptor.

2. Gut Microbiome & Cravings

This is a more nuanced and potentially significant area.

  • Artificial Sweeteners & Gut Health: Some animal and preliminary human studies suggest certain artificial sweeteners (like saccharin, and to a lesser extent sucralose) can alter gut bacteria composition, potentially promoting glucose intolerance. The data on aspartame and Ace-K is less clear, but it's an active research area. A disrupted gut microbiome could, in theory, impact metabolic health and inflammation—counter to some fasting goals.
  • The "Sweetness Trap": For many, consuming a hyper-sweet beverage during a fast can intensify cravings and make the fasting period psychologically harder. It keeps the taste receptors and brain's reward pathways engaged in "sweet mode," potentially leading to increased hunger or difficulty adhering to the fast. This is a personal, psychological factor that can indirectly "break" your fast by causing you to give in and eat.

3. Caffeine: A Double-Edged Sword

Coke Zero contains about 34mg of caffeine per 12oz can.

  • Pros: Caffeine can suppress appetite, boost metabolism slightly, and enhance focus—potentially helping you get through your fast.
  • Cons: Caffeine can disrupt sleep if consumed late in the day, and poor sleep harms metabolic health and fasting adaptation. It can also increase anxiety or digestive discomfort in sensitive individuals. Caffeine itself does not "break" a fast metabolically (it has negligible calories), but its side effects are worth considering.

4. Phosphoric Acid & Mineral Balance

Phosphoric acid is added for tartness. High chronic intake of phosphoric acid (common in many sodas) is associated with concerns about bone health and calcium balance due to potential effects on parathyroid hormone. However, the amount in one can is small. During a short-term fast, this is unlikely to be a major concern, but it's not a "health-promoting" ingredient.

Expert Opinions & Fasting Community Divide

The fasting community is split.

  • The "Strict Purist" Camp: Advocates for water, black coffee, and plain tea only. Their argument is philosophical and precautionary: any substance with a taste or biological activity (beyond hydration) is an unnecessary stressor or potential disruptor. They cite the unknown long-term effects of artificial sweeteners and the importance of a "clean" metabolic signal.
  • The "Pragmatic Permissive" Camp: Argues that zero-calorie beverages are fair game. Their logic is purely caloric: if it has no calories, it doesn't break the fast. They point to studies showing no insulin spike and view diet soda as a valuable tool for adherence, especially for beginners.
  • The "Metabolic Individualist" Camp: Believes the answer is highly personal. They recommend self-experimentation: track your hunger, energy, and if possible, use a CGM or blood ketone meter to see if Coke Zero knocks you out of ketosis or causes a glucose/insulin response.

Most mainstream medical and nutrition experts who specialize in fasting (like Dr. Jason Fung, Dr. Peter Attia) tend toward the pragmatic view for weight loss goals, acknowledging that non-caloric sweeteners are unlikely to provide enough of an insulin signal to meaningfully impede fat loss. However, they often caution against their use for overall health and recommend water as the ideal.

Practical Guide: How to Decide For Yourself

If you’re wondering "does Coke Zero break a fast for me," here is an actionable framework:

  1. Identify Your Primary Goal:

    • Weight Loss / Calorie Deficit: Coke Zero is likely fine. It provides zero calories and likely no significant insulin spike.
    • Deep Autophagy (24-72 hour fasts):Likely fine, but purists avoid all non-water substances.
    • Improving Insulin Sensitivity / Reversing Prediabetes:Proceed with caution. If you are insulin resistant, test your response. Consider avoiding it initially to reset your palate and metabolic pathways.
    • Gut Health / Reducing Inflammation:Probably best avoided. The potential gut microbiome effects, while not definitively proven, are a negative mark.
  2. Conduct a Personal Experiment (The N=1 Approach):

    • Baseline: Fast for 16-18 hours with only water. Note your hunger, energy, mental clarity.
    • Test: On another fasting day, drink a can of Coke Zero at your usual craving time (e.g., 2 PM). Monitor how you feel for the next 2-4 hours. Do you feel hungrier? More fatigued? Any digestive upset?
    • Advanced Test (If Possible): Use a CGM (Continuous Glucose Monitor). See if your glucose or inferred insulin rises within 30-60 minutes of drinking it. Use a blood ketone meter. Does your ketone level drop significantly after consumption?
  3. Consider the Psychological Impact: Be brutally honest. Does drinking Coke Zero make you crave food more? Does it make you feel like you're "cheating" and thus more likely to break your fast early? If yes, it's breaking your fast in spirit and harming adherence.

  4. Prioritize & Phase: If you love Coke Zero, use it strategically. Perhaps allow it only in the last hour of your fast to take the edge off, rather than sipping it all afternoon. Or, use it as a transitional tool while you adapt to fasting, with the goal of weaning off to water and herbal tea.

Common Questions Answered

Q: Will one can of Coke Zero ruin my fast?
A: For weight loss, almost certainly not. One can has no calories. The minor, transient insulin response (if any) is unlikely to halt fat burning for more than a very short period. Don't let perfectionism derail your progress.

Q: Is Coke Zero better than regular soda for fasting?
A: Infinitely better. Regular Coke has ~39g of sugar and 140 calories, which will absolutely spike insulin, provide energy, and break your fast immediately. Coke Zero is a vastly superior choice if you must have soda.

Q: What about other zero-calorie drinks?
A: The same principles apply. Club soda/seltzer (just carbonated water) is the safest. Flavored sparkling water with natural essences is generally fine. Other diet sodas (Diet Coke, Pepsi Zero) contain similar sweetener blends (aspartame, Ace-K) and are equivalent to Coke Zero. Stevia or Monk Fruit-sweetened drinks may be better for gut health, but the sweet taste issue remains.

Q: Does the caffeine in Coke Zero break a fast?
A: No. Caffeine has negligible calories. Its effects are stimulant-based (appetite suppression, alertness), not metabolic in terms of breaking the fasted state. Just be mindful of timing and potential side effects.

Q: I’m doing a 72-hour fast for autophagy. Is Coke Zero okay?
A: Technically, yes, as it provides no nutrients. However, many pursuing deep cellular renewal choose to eliminate all taste stimuli to maximize the body's stress response (hormesis) and avoid any potential, even theoretical, disruptions. Water is the gold standard for prolonged therapeutic fasts.

The Verdict: A Nuanced "Probably Not, But..."

So, does Coke Zero break a fast? After dissecting the science, the most accurate answer is:

For the majority of people practicing intermittent fasting for weight loss or general metabolic health, drinking Coke Zero during the fasting window is unlikely to provide enough of a metabolic signal (insulin, glucose) to meaningfully "break" the fast or halt fat burning.

However, this comes with important caveats:

  1. It is not "healthy." It contains artificial chemicals, acids, and provides no hydration benefit over water.
  2. It may harm gut health or increase cravings in susceptible individuals.
  3. For specific goals like maximizing autophagy or healing severe insulin resistance, it's best avoided as a precaution.
  4. Your individual response matters most. You must be your own scientist.
